Almost Gone by Caedmon S Call guitar tab (text):"Almost Gone" by Caedmon's Call From "The Awakening Compilation" Words and music by Derek Webb Copyright 1996 Thirsty Plant Music Capo 2 in G (A), standard-tuned six-string acoustic. Moderate tempo in 4. This is a powerful song, all strumming and flat-picking. It begins in E minor, then modulates between E minor for the verses and G major for the chorus, and to E major for bridge 2. (everything relative to the capo) It's a fairly easy yet impressive and beautiful song that can work well with just one guitar and even with just one voice singing both parts of bridge 1 and the chorus. (Derek sings lead, Cliff sings the parts in (parentheses), Danielle sings the parts in {braces}, and they all harmonize on bridge 2) The lyrics in ALL CAPS are what I sing when performing solo. Before the intro, begin by strumming Em for two bars. Unless you have someone playing recorder--more in that case. At the end, finish with another G, Am7, D9, then a short C (X32010), hammering the second string, followed by a single strummed G, pulling off the second string. Note: thanks to Derek Webb for taking the time after a concert to show me how you play this.
